About this course

With a growing demand for professionals who can provide specialized care and support for military families, this course equips learners with essential skills for career advancement. By completing this program, learners will gain a deep understanding of the military lifestyle, its impact on children's development, and evidence-based strategies for promoting resilience and wellbeing. Whether you are a mental health professional, teacher, or social worker, this course will provide you with the knowledge and skills necessary to make a meaningful difference in the lives of military children and their families.

Course Details

β€’ Military Family Dynamics & Child Development
β€’ Supporting Military Children During Deployments
β€’ Trauma Informed Care & Resilience Building
β€’ Education & Special Education Considerations for Military Children
β€’ Promoting Mental Health in Military Children
β€’ Military Child Wellbeing Policy & Advocacy
β€’ Strengthening Military Families through Community Engagement
β€’ Research Methods in Military Child Wellbeing
β€’ Cultural Competence & Diversity in Military Family Support
